版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領
文檔簡介
《高性能計算機講義》PPT課件本課件涵蓋了高性能計算機的定義、應用場景、并行計算的基本原理、體系結構、編程模型等內(nèi)容。通過深入講解并行計算的核心技術,幫助學生全面掌握高性能計算的基礎知識和實踐技能。ppbypptppt課程概述本課程深入討論高性能計算的概念及其在科學研究、工程應用、數(shù)據(jù)分析等領域的廣泛應用。我們將全面探討并行計算的基本原理、系統(tǒng)架構、編程模型以及相關的算法設計與優(yōu)化技術。通過生動的案例分析,幫助學生掌握高性能計算的理論知識和實踐技能,為今后的科研或工作打下堅實基礎。高性能計算的定義和應用場景1科學研究氣候模擬、基因組分析、物理模擬等2工程應用汽車設計、航空航天、制造過程優(yōu)化3數(shù)據(jù)分析大數(shù)據(jù)處理、機器學習、人工智能高性能計算(HighPerformanceComputing,HPC)是指利用并行計算技術,提高計算機系統(tǒng)的整體計算能力和運算速度,以滿足復雜問題求解的需求。它廣泛應用于科學研究、工程應用和數(shù)據(jù)分析等諸多領域,為人類社會的發(fā)展做出了重要貢獻。并行計算的基本原理任務分解將復雜問題拆分為多個可并行執(zhí)行的子任務,以提高整體計算效率。資源共享多個處理單元協(xié)同工作,共享計算資源,如內(nèi)存、存儲和網(wǎng)絡等。通信協(xié)調(diào)子任務之間需要通過高速網(wǎng)絡進行數(shù)據(jù)交換和協(xié)調(diào),確保正確運行。并行計算的分類和特點1基于并行粒度的分類并行計算可分為任務并行、數(shù)據(jù)并行和流水線并行三種主要方式。每種方式針對不同的并行需求和應用場景。2基于體系結構的分類根據(jù)內(nèi)存和處理器的組織方式,并行計算系統(tǒng)可分為共享存儲、分布式存儲和混合存儲架構。3并行計算的特點并行計算的核心優(yōu)勢包括計算速度快、資源利用高、可擴展性強和容錯性好等。但同時也面臨著同步、通信和負載均衡等挑戰(zhàn)。并行計算機的體系結構1共享存儲系統(tǒng)多處理器共享同一個主內(nèi)存,通過高速緩存實現(xiàn)數(shù)據(jù)交換2分布式存儲系統(tǒng)每個處理器擁有自己的本地內(nèi)存,通過互連網(wǎng)絡進行通信3混合存儲系統(tǒng)結合共享存儲和分布式存儲的優(yōu)點,提高性能和擴展性并行計算機的體系結構決定了其內(nèi)存訪問方式和處理器組織方式,直接影響系統(tǒng)的性能和擴展性。常見的體系結構包括共享存儲系統(tǒng)、分布式存儲系統(tǒng)和混合存儲系統(tǒng)。每種架構都有其適用的應用場景和優(yōu)缺點,需要根據(jù)具體需求進行選擇。共享存儲系統(tǒng)1全局內(nèi)存所有處理器共享同一個主內(nèi)存2高速緩存利用緩存加速內(nèi)存訪問和數(shù)據(jù)傳輸3互連網(wǎng)絡處理器之間通過快速總線或交換機連接共享存儲系統(tǒng)是一種典型的并行計算機體系結構。在這種架構中,所有處理器共享同一個全局主內(nèi)存,通過高速緩存和互連網(wǎng)絡進行數(shù)據(jù)交換和同步。這種緊耦合的設計可以有效提高內(nèi)存訪問速度和數(shù)據(jù)傳輸效率,適用于需要頻繁數(shù)據(jù)共享的并行應用。但同時也面臨著內(nèi)存訪問沖突和擴展性問題。分布式存儲系統(tǒng)分布式內(nèi)存每個處理器都擁有自己的本地內(nèi)存,不共享全局內(nèi)存。消息傳遞處理器之間通過高速互連網(wǎng)絡進行顯式的數(shù)據(jù)傳輸和消息交換。負載均衡通過動態(tài)調(diào)度和工作竊取等機制,實現(xiàn)計算任務的高效分配。互連網(wǎng)絡1高速總線在同步處理器間進行快速數(shù)據(jù)傳輸2交換網(wǎng)絡采用高性能交換機實現(xiàn)異步通信3路由器互聯(lián)基于TCP/IP協(xié)議實現(xiàn)廣域網(wǎng)互連互連網(wǎng)絡是并行計算系統(tǒng)中至關重要的組成部分。它負責在多個處理單元之間高效傳輸數(shù)據(jù)和指令,確保整個系統(tǒng)能夠協(xié)調(diào)工作。常見的互連技術包括高速總線、交換網(wǎng)絡和路由器互聯(lián)等,它們各有優(yōu)缺點并適用于不同的應用場景。合理選擇和優(yōu)化互連網(wǎng)絡是提升并行系統(tǒng)性能的關鍵。并行程序設計模型1共享內(nèi)存模型多個線程共享同一個內(nèi)存空間,通過讀寫共享變量進行數(shù)據(jù)交換和同步。這種模型編程靈活,但需要小心處理并發(fā)訪問問題。2消息傳遞模型各個進程或線程通過發(fā)送和接收消息進行通信和協(xié)作。這種模型更加明確地劃分了任務邊界,但需要處理復雜的消息機制。3混合模型結合共享內(nèi)存和消息傳遞的優(yōu)點,在不同粒度上采用不同的并行設計模式。這種模型靈活性強,但設計和調(diào)試更加復雜。并行算法設計原則1分解原則將復雜問題拆分為多個可并行執(zhí)行的子任務,充分利用各處理單元的計算能力。2局部性原則盡量減少子任務之間的交互和同步,降低通信開銷,提高并行效率。3負載均衡原則合理分配任務,確保各處理單元的工作量大致相當,避免資源浪費。任務并行化問題分解將復雜的計算問題拆分成多個可獨立執(zhí)行的子任務,以充分發(fā)揮并行計算的優(yōu)勢。任務調(diào)度根據(jù)任務特點和系統(tǒng)資源,制定合理的任務調(diào)度策略,實現(xiàn)負載均衡。通信協(xié)調(diào)子任務之間需要進行必要的通信和同步,以確保最終結果的正確性。性能優(yōu)化分析任務間的數(shù)據(jù)依賴和通信開銷,采取措施提高并行計算的整體效率。數(shù)據(jù)并行化1分解數(shù)據(jù)將大規(guī)模數(shù)據(jù)集劃分成多個互不重疊的子數(shù)據(jù)塊2分配任務將數(shù)據(jù)子塊分配給不同的處理單元獨立處理3整合結果將各處理單元的局部結果合并為最終的整體輸出數(shù)據(jù)并行化是一種常見的并行計算方式,適用于大規(guī)模數(shù)據(jù)處理場景。它通過將數(shù)據(jù)集劃分成互不重疊的子塊,并將這些子塊分配給不同的處理單元進行獨立計算,最后再將局部結果整合為最終輸出。這種并行方式可以大幅提高處理效率,同時也充分利用了系統(tǒng)的計算資源。其關鍵在于如何合理地進行數(shù)據(jù)分解和結果合并,以確保整體計算的正確性和高性能。流水線并行化1任務分解將復雜的計算任務劃分為多個相互獨立的子任務2流水線設計為每個子任務安排專門的處理單元,按順序執(zhí)行3任務調(diào)度合理分配和調(diào)度子任務,確保流水線高效運行流水線并行化是一種常見的并行計算模式。它將復雜的計算任務劃分為多個獨立的子任務,然后為每個子任務安排專門的處理單元。這些處理單元按順序執(zhí)行各自的子任務,形成一條高效的計算流水線。合理的任務調(diào)度策略是確保流水線并行化能夠發(fā)揮最大效果的關鍵。編程工具和環(huán)境1并行編程語言C、C++、Fortran等傳統(tǒng)語言提供了豐富的并行編程API。此外,Python、Java等高級語言也有專門的并行庫支持。2開發(fā)工具IntelParallelStudio、NVIDIAHPCSDK等專業(yè)的并行計算開發(fā)套件,提供編譯器、調(diào)試器和性能分析工具。3高性能計算框架MPI、OpenMP、CUDA等并行計算框架,為并行程序的設計、調(diào)試和優(yōu)化提供了強大的支持。性能分析和優(yōu)化性能評測采用基準測試、仿真分析等方法,全面評估并行系統(tǒng)的性能特征。瓶頸分析通過性能剖析工具,精確定位系統(tǒng)中的性能瓶頸,為優(yōu)化提供依據(jù)。代碼優(yōu)化針對瓶頸所在,優(yōu)化算法邏輯、內(nèi)存訪問、通信開銷等關鍵因素。架構優(yōu)化根據(jù)應用需求,選擇合適的并行體系結構和互連網(wǎng)絡拓撲進行優(yōu)化。高性能計算案例分析1氣象預報復雜天氣模擬2金融分析大規(guī)模金融數(shù)據(jù)處理3分子建模量子力學計算4醫(yī)學影像醫(yī)療數(shù)據(jù)分析高性能計算在多個領域發(fā)揮著重要作用,如天氣預報、金融分析、分子建模和醫(yī)學影像處理等。這些應用都涉及大規(guī)模、復雜的數(shù)值計算,需要利用并行計算技術來加速運算過程。通過對這些具體案例的分析,我們可以了解高性能計算在不同領域的實際應用和技術要點。GPU加速計算1顯卡架構優(yōu)化針對并行計算優(yōu)化的GPU硬件架構2CUDA編程模型基于C/C++的GPU并行編程框架3加速算法設計利用GPU并行性加速復雜計算算法GPU加速計算利用圖形處理單元(GPU)的大規(guī)模并行計算能力,在高性能計算領域發(fā)揮著愈加重要的作用。這需要從硬件架構優(yōu)化、軟件編程模型到算法設計等多個層面進行深入研究和創(chuàng)新。通過GPU架構的優(yōu)化、CUDA編程模型的應用,以及針對特定計算問題的并行算法設計,可以大幅提升復雜計算任務的處理速度和效率。云計算和大數(shù)據(jù)處理1云計算基礎設施基于分布式存儲和虛擬化技術的彈性計算平臺,滿足大規(guī)模數(shù)據(jù)處理的需求。2大數(shù)據(jù)分析工具包括Hadoop、Spark等開源框架,提供分布式數(shù)據(jù)處理、機器學習等功能。3實時數(shù)據(jù)處理利用流計算技術實現(xiàn)對海量實時數(shù)據(jù)的實時分析和洞察,支持業(yè)務快速決策。量子計算1量子力學基礎基于量子力學原理的計算模型2量子位與量子門量子比特和基本量子操作3量子算法設計利用量子效應實現(xiàn)高效計算4量子計算硬件量子計算機原型及其挑戰(zhàn)量子計算基于量子力學原理,利用量子位和量子門等獨特的量子特性來實現(xiàn)超越傳統(tǒng)計算的高效運算。量子算法設計是關鍵,通過巧妙利用量子效應來解決經(jīng)典計算機難以處理的復雜問題。目前量子計算硬件仍面臨諸多技術障礙,但已有一些原型機問世,為未來的突破奠定基礎。未來發(fā)展趨勢硬件加速未來計算硬件將繼續(xù)朝著多核、異構和可編程化的方向發(fā)展,為高性能計算提供更強大的底層支持。算法創(chuàng)新在大數(shù)據(jù)、人工智能等領域,新型并行算法和機器學習算法將不斷涌現(xiàn),提高復雜計算的效率和準確性。系統(tǒng)優(yōu)化高性能計算系統(tǒng)將進一步向軟硬件協(xié)同優(yōu)化、自動化和可視化的方向發(fā)展,提高整體性能??缃缛诤细咝阅苡嬎銓⑴c云計算、大數(shù)據(jù)、量子計算等前沿技術深度融合,實現(xiàn)新的技術突破和應用創(chuàng)新。課程總結通過本課程的學習,我們?nèi)媪私饬烁咝阅苡嬎愕幕驹?、并行計算的關鍵技術,以及在各領域的典型應用。從硬件架構優(yōu)化、并行算法設計到性能分析和優(yōu)化,都有深入探討。未來高性能計算將繼續(xù)向多核、異構、自動化和云融合的方向發(fā)展,為科研、工業(yè)和生活帶來更多創(chuàng)新應用。問題討論在課程學習的最后階段,我們將對高性能計算相關的一些關鍵問題展開探討和交流。包括技術發(fā)展趨勢、應用前景、挑戰(zhàn)和機遇等方面。通過師生互動,深化對本課程內(nèi)容的理解,并對未來研究方向提出建議。參考文獻本課程內(nèi)容中引用了大量國內(nèi)外學術論文和專業(yè)著作,涵蓋了并行計算、高性能計算、GPU加速、云計算和量子計算等相關領域的最新研究成果。這些參考文獻為我們提供了理論基礎和技術支持,為進一步深入探索高性能計算的前沿動態(tài)奠定了堅實的基礎。課程反饋我們非常重視每位學生的學習體驗和反饋意見。請您在課
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025-2030年中國高頻頭行業(yè)市場現(xiàn)狀調(diào)研及發(fā)展前景研究報告
- 2025-2030年中國重質(zhì)純堿行業(yè)發(fā)展現(xiàn)狀及前景趨勢分析報告
- 2025-2030年中國避孕藥市場規(guī)模分析及發(fā)展戰(zhàn)略決策研究報告新版
- 公共就業(yè)服務網(wǎng)絡招聘與線上就業(yè)服務考核試卷
- 健康保險的疾病早期篩查考核試卷
- 園藝陶瓷的生態(tài)環(huán)保設計理念傳播策略考核試卷
- 體育表演培訓教材研發(fā)考核試卷
- 2025年度退休人員社區(qū)圖書管理勞務合同
- 創(chuàng)業(yè)企業(yè)的社會責任實踐考核試卷
- 商業(yè)綜合體員工福利計劃與員工關懷考核試卷
- TSGD7002-2023-壓力管道元件型式試驗規(guī)則
- 2024年度家庭醫(yī)生簽約服務培訓課件
- 建筑工地節(jié)前停工安全檢查表
- 了不起的狐貍爸爸-全文打印
- 液相色譜質(zhì)譜質(zhì)譜儀LCMSMSSYSTEM
- 民辦非企業(yè)單位章程核準表-空白表格
- 派克與永華互換表
- 第二章流體靜力學基礎
- 小學高年級語文作文情景互動教學策略探究教研課題論文開題中期結題報告教學反思經(jīng)驗交流
- 春節(jié)新年紅燈籠中國風信紙
- 注塑件生產(chǎn)通用標準
評論
0/150
提交評論